Relative Clauses
In English language there are 7 types of clauses, relative clauses are amongst them. (relative clause = relatiivlause e. kõrvallause, mis enamasti laiendab pealause nimisõnafraasi.)
A relative clause gives additional information about a noun, a pronoun or a verb. They contain relative pronouns:
who (whom) = PEOPLE
which = THINGS
whose = POSSESSIONS
when = TIME
where = PLACE
what = VERBS
that = PEOPLE or THINGS (it's a relative adverb)
Words who / which /that can be omitted if they act as objects. Don't use commas in relative clauses, but you have to use them in non-relative / non-defining sentences. In formal language WHOM is often used instead of who or who to
Examples
1) This the man who helped me in the accident. (the man = subject, therefore the pronoun who can't be omitted. It is a relative clause => no commas needed. )
2) The car (that) I bought last year broke down. ( the car = object, therefore the pronoun that can be omitted.)
3) The house, whose roof was damaged, is being repaired. (the house = subject, therefore the pronoun can't be omitted. It's a non-defining relative clause => commas are needed.)
PS! subject - alus, object - sihitis
The easiest way to check whether a sentence is a non-defining relative clause => read the sentence without clause and a non-defining clause makes another independent sentence.
